Combined Surgical Strategy for Large Cystic Brain Metastases: A Case Series of Fractionated Stereotactic Radiotherapy
Kei Iwamoto1,2, Jo Sasame1, Shigeo Matsunaga1
1Department of Neurosurgery, Yokohama Rosai Hospital, Yokohama, Japan.
Background:
Stereotactic radiotherapy (SRT) is a less invasive, widely accepted treatment for brain metastases, particularly in patients with poor general condition. However, large cystic metastases can complicate radiotherapy because of their morphology. This study evaluated the efficacy and safety of continuous cyst drainage under natural pressure combined with fractionated SRT (f-SRT) for these lesions.
Methods:
We retrospectively reviewed patients treated at Yokohama Rosai Hospital between August 2022 and February 2024. Eligible patients had cystic brain metastases ≥10 cm³ and underwent cyst drainage under local or general anesthesia, followed by f-SRT (35 Gy in 5 fractions). Outcomes included Karnofsky Performance Status (KPS), tumor and cyst volumes, local control, and neurological symptoms.
Results:
Four patients (one male, three females; median age, 52 years) were analyzed. Primary cancers were lung (n=1), breast (n=1), breast and lung (n=1), and esophageal (n=1). After drainage, median KPS increased from 65 to 70, and neurological symptoms improved in three cases. Tumor volume decreased from 35.6 cm³ to 12.4 cm³ (65.5% reduction). No treatment-related complications or radiation-induced adverse events were observed.
Conclusion:
Continuous cyst drainage under natural pressure combined with f-SRT appears safe and effective for large cystic metastases, enabling continuation of f-SRT in patients who are not suitable candidates for resection and providing a minimally invasive treatment option.
